Urgent Call: Japanese Abductees’ Families Seek US Support Japanese abductees’ families highlight urgent need for US-Japan collaboration to resolve long-standing abduction issue by North Korea. Relatives of Japanese abductees met with US officials to seek support for a swift resolution to this human rights issue.The primary concern is the return of the 12 identified Japanese nationals abducted by North Korea in the 1970s and 1980s.The US Department of State reaffirmed its commitment to supporting Japan in resolving the abduction cases immediately.The delegation missed a meeting with the US Secretary of State but expects to reschedule later this week. Devastating Water Flood Hits Kyoto City, Impacting 6,000 Kyoto Water Pipe: Water gushing from a broken pipe inundates highway in Shimogyo Ward, affecting over 6,000 households. Water from a broken pipe floods Kyoto’s Shimogyo Ward.Over 6,000 homes may face tap water contamination risks.Traffic disruptions occur due to inundated highways.Clean water trucks sent to address resident’s needs. Powerful New Destroyer: North Korea’s Bold Military Advance Destroyer debuts: North Korea tests cruise missiles and ship-to-ship tactical guided weapons in a show of maritime strength. North Korea debuted the Choe Hyon, a 5,000-ton-class destroyer.Kim Jong Un observed tests of advanced missiles, including supersonic and strategic cruise types.The destroyer features advanced combat capabilities and vertical missile launch systems.This unveils North Korea’s plans to accelerate naval nuclear armament. Devastating Impact: US Tariffs Slash Japan’s Earnings by Billions Tariffs – Japanese firms see profits dip as US tariffs increase costs, with machinery and electronics sectors particularly hit. Japanese companies forecast significant profit losses due to US tariffs.Komatsu predicts over 94 billion yen drop in operating profit.Hitachi plans to offset losses by regionalizing manufacturing. Inspiring Youth Call for a Safer Nuclear-Free World at UN Nuclear-Free World: Japanese youths advocate for a safer future at the United Nations and engage in global peace initiatives. Students from Hiroshima and Nagasaki urged nuclear disarmament at the UN.The appeal coincided with a preparatory meeting for the Nuclear Non-Proliferation Treaty review.Speakers emphasized the importance of preserving hibakusha testimonies for future generations.UN official Nakamitsu Izumi praised youth engagement and their demand for a safer world. Japan’s Bold Tariff Talks: Top Negotiator Heads to US for 2nd Round Tariff Talks: Japan’s key trade negotiator Akazawa Ryosei aims to secure a balanced agreement in ongoing US discussions. Japan’s top negotiator Akazawa Ryosei seeks to secure a balanced trade agreement in Washington discussions.The US side is urging Japan to increase imports of autos and agricultural products.Akazawa aims to advocate for reduced tariffs while seeking mutually beneficial terms.The Trump administration appears optimistic, but skepticism exists within Japan’s government circles. Heartfelt Tribute: Honoring 520 Lives Lost in JAL Crash after 40 Years JAL Crash: Relatives of crash victims visit Osutaka Ridge to honor victims, marking solemn remembrance of world’s worst plane accident. Relatives of JAL crash victims visited the site to honor their loved ones, 40 years after the tragedy.The crash, which occurred on August 12, 1985, marked the world’s worst single-plane accident with 520 lives lost.Aging relatives emphasize the importance of preserving the victims’ legacy and seek continued support from JAL and local authorities. Tragic Drone Attacks Leave Lives Shattered: 10 Critical Details Drone Attacks: Russia continues relentless strikes on Ukraine, killing a child and injuring civilians during early morning assaults. Russian drone attacks kill a 12-year-old girl in Ukraine and injure several others in the Dnipropetrovsk region.Another drone attack in Kyiv caused injuries and a fire due to falling debris.A Ukrainian drone strike in Belgorod, Russia, resulted in two fatalities.Putin declared a unilateral ceasefire marking the Soviet victory over Nazi Germany. Trump’s Bold Tariff Shift: A Controversial Support Move with 3 Key Changes Tariffs: Trump announced relaxed automobile tariffs to aid manufacturing in the US, ensuring smoother transitions for automakers. President Trump eases automobile tariffs to support US manufacturing.Automakers will receive temporary reimbursement on tariffs for foreign parts.The new policy will be phased out over two years before removal.The measure aims to motivate companies to localize auto parts production in the US.
